
JISOO
Biography
Kim Ji-soo (born January 3, 1995), known mononymously as JISOO, is a South Korean singer and actress. She is a member of the South Korean girl group Blackpink, formed by YG Entertainment, in August 2016. Outside of her music career, she made her acting debut with a cameo role in the 2015 series The Producers and played her first leading role in the JTBC series Snowdrop (2021–22), for which she won the Best Actress Award at the 2022 Seoul International Drama Awards. JISOO made her solo music debut with the single album Me on March 31, 2023. The album debuted at number one on the Circle Album Chart with 1.03 million copies sold in less than two days, becoming the best-selling album of all time by a female soloist in South Korea and the first to sell over a million copies. In 2024, she established her own label named Blissoo. JISOO has been awarded several accolades throughout her career, including two Golden Disc Awards, three MAMA Awards, a Circle Chart Music Award, and the Seoul International Drama Award for Outstanding Korean Actress. She is the most-followed Korean actress on Instagram, and has been recognized for her impact on fashion as a global ambassador for Dior.
